Design and delivery of five private houses
BTP were architects on William's Row, a £1.75m residential development on Chapel Road, located within a well-established residential area close to Sale Town Centre.
Named after composer John Williams and delivered for Trafford Council, the scheme marks the first outright sale development of its type to be brought forward by the Council.
The completed development comprises five new four-bedroom homes, four semi-detached and one detached, designed to provide high-quality, functional and modern living for future residents. The homes were constructed to a very high standard by contractor J Greenwood (Builders) Limited, with engineering support from P&G Consulting.
The project involved the demolition of two existing buildings to prepare the site for redevelopment. BTP’s design approach responded sensitively to its surroundings, drawing cues from the Claremont Centre and the area’s varied architectural character and surrounding housing.
